Freigeben über


Viewer.LayerColor-Eigenschaft (Visio Viewer)

Ruft die Farbe der Ebene an der angegebenen Indexposition in der aktuellen Zeichnung ab, die in Microsoft Visio Viewer geöffnet ist, oder legt diese fest. Lese-/Schreibzugriff.

Syntax

Ausdruck. LayerColor (LayerIndex)

Ausdruck Ein Ausdruck, der ein Viewer-Objekt zurückgibt.

Parameter

Name Erforderlich/Optional Datentyp Beschreibung
LayerIndex Erforderlich Long Der Index der Ebene in der Auflistung von Ebenen in der Zeichnung, die in Visio Viewer geöffnet ist.

Rückgabewert

OLE_COLOR

Hinweise

Gibt einen Wert vom Datentyp OLE_COLOR zurück, der die Farbe der angegebenen Ebene in Visio Viewer darstellt. Der Datentyp OLE_COLOR wird für Eigenschaften verwendet, die Farben zurückgeben.

Gültige Hexadezimalwerte für einen OLE_COLOR Datentyp in Visio Viewer haben die Form &Hbbggrr, wobei bb der blaue Wert ist, gg den grünen Wert und rr den roten Wert. Alle drei Farbwerte liegen zwischen 00 und FF hexadezimal (255 Dezimalwerte).

Die Auflistung der Ebenen ist einsbasiert, sodass der Index der ersten Ebene in der Auflistung 1 ist. Wenn keine Ebenen in der Zeichnung vorhanden sind oder Sie den Index einer nicht vorhandenen Ebene übergeben, gibt die LayerColor-Eigenschaft 0 zurück.

Beispiel

Der folgende Code zeigt, wie Die Farbe der Ebene an Indexposition 1 in der in Visio Viewer geöffneten Zeichnung abgerufen wird.

Debug.Print vsoViewer.LayerColor(1)

Support und Feedback

Haben Sie Fragen oder Feedback zu Office VBA oder zu dieser Dokumentation? Unter Office VBA-Support und Feedback finden Sie Hilfestellung zu den Möglichkeiten, wie Sie Support erhalten und Feedback abgeben können.